Move NetworkPolicy from apps to UID.

For multi-user devices, switch to storing policy per-user instead of
per-app.  Also watch for user added/removed broadcasts to clean up
policies and apply global restrictions.

Bug: 7121279
Change-Id: Ia7326bd0ebe0586fa4ec6d3a62f6313dc8814007
